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 8-K reports the results of the Annual Meeting of Stockholders for NORTHERN OIL & GAS, INC. held on May 21, 2026. The filing details the outcomes of three proposals submitted to security holders: the election of directors, the ratification of the independent auditor, and a nonbinding advisory vote on executive compensation.

Material Changes and Voting Results
Proposal One: Election of Directors
All seven nominees were elected. The voting breakdown is as follows:
| Director Nominee | For | Withheld | Broker Non-Votes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bahram Akradi | 82,693,927 | 1,527,828 | 11,512,850 |
| Lisa Bromiley | 83,044,417 | 1,177,338 | 11,512,850 |
| Michael Frantz | 83,153,329 | 1,068,426 | 11,512,850 |
| William Kimble | 82,964,115 | 1,257,640 | 11,512,850 |
| Stuart Lasher | 83,511,275 | 710,480 | 11,512,850 |
| Nicholas O'Grady | 83,772,877 | 448,878 | 11,512,850 |
| Jennifer Pomerantz | 78,312,649 | 5,909,106 | 11,512,850 |
Proposal Two: Ratification of Auditor
Stockholders ratified the appointment of Deloitte & Touche LLP as the independent registered public accounting firm for the fiscal year ending December 31, 2026.
- For: 95,171,334
- Against: 231,128
- Abstain: 332,143
Proposal Three: Executive Compensation (Say-on-Pay)
Stockholders approved the compensation of Named Executive Officers on a nonbinding advisory basis.
- For: 80,671,263
- Against: 2,986,714
- Abstain: 563,778
- Broker Non-Votes: 11,512,850
